People love winning streaks by individuals — teams, not so much

Monday, August 31, 2020 - 09:31 in Psychology & Sociology

People enjoy witnessing extraordinary individuals – from athletes to CEOs – extend long runs of dominance in their fields, a new study suggests. But they aren’t as interested in seeing similar streaks of success by teams or groups. “Everyone wants Usain Bolt to win another gold medal for sprinting. Not so many people want to see the New […]
